Champagne Experience

Champagne is one of the most renowned sparkling wines in the world synonymous with celebration in almost every country on earth.

Whether situated in the larger towns or set among the vineyards, the Champagne Houses are magical places. With over 7,000 Champagne Houses scattered throughout the region it is difficult to know where to begin.

Wine Tasting France carefully picks a selection of both larger reputable estates such as Veuve Clicquot and Moet & Chandon as well as discovering along the way smaller quality growers in the villages.

Visiting smaller family estates where you will be warmly welcomed into their homes, inviting you to look around their cellars, taste their wines and share in their passion.
